District Information
District Overview
| District | State Average | |
|---|---|---|
| Graduation Rate | 92.6% | 82.2% |
| Dropout Rate | 1.3% | 2.8% |
| Per Pupil Spending | $15,824 | $14,642 |
| Students Per Teacher | 11.3 | 11.7 |
| Number of Schools | 17 | - |
| Number of Students | 9,956 | - |
| Number of (FTE) Teachers | 878 | - |

District Financial Details (2008)
Revenues For Education
| Percent of Total | ||
|---|---|---|
| Total Revenues | $175,807,000 | - |
| Total Local Revenues | $153,431,000 | 87.3% |
| Parent Government Contributions | $150,704,000 | 85.7% |
| School Lunch | $2,639,000 | 1.5% |
| District Activity Receipts | $49,000 | 0.03% |
| Rents and Royalties | $39,000 | 0.02% |
| Total State Revenues | $19,163,000 | 10.9% |
| General Formula Assistance | $523,000 | 0.3% |
| Special Education Programs | $5,330,000 | 3.0% |
| School Lunch Programs | $27,000 | 0.02% |
| Capital Outlay and Debt Services Programs | $741,000 | 0.4% |
| Transportation Programs | $73,000 | 0.04% |
| Other Programs | $308,000 | 0.2% |
| State Revenues on Behalf - Employee Benefits | $12,161,000 | 6.9% |
| Total Federal Revenues | $3,213,000 | 1.8% |
| Through State - Title I | $329,000 | 0.2% |
| Through State - Children With Disabilities (IDEA) | $2,303,000 | 1.3% |
| Through State - Math, Science and Teacher Quality | $161,000 | 0.09% |
| Through State - Safe and Drug Free Schools | $25,000 | 0.01% |
| Through State - Title V, Part A | $7,000 | 0.00% |
| Through State - Vocational and Tech Education | $66,000 | 0.04% |
| Through State - Bilingual Education | $30,000 | 0.02% |
| Through State - Child Nutrition Act | $288,000 | 0.2% |
| Through State - Other | $4,000 | 0.00% |
Expenditures For Education
| Percent of Total | ||
|---|---|---|
| Total Current Expenditures | $154,709,000 | - |
| Total Instruction Expenditures | $90,110,000 | 58.2% |
| Total Support Services Expenditures | $59,638,000 | 38.5% |
| Student Support | $11,392,000 | 6.5% |
| Instructional Staff Support | $9,121,000 | 5.2% |
| General Administration Support | $1,556,000 | 0.9% |
| School Administration Support | $9,668,000 | 5.5% |
| Operation and Maintenance Support | $16,287,000 | 9.3% |
| Student Transportation Support | $7,206,000 | 4.1% |
| Other Support Services | $4,408,000 | 2.5% |
| Total Other Expenditures | $4,961,000 | 3.2% |
| Food Services | $3,009,000 | 1.7% |
| Enterprise Operations | $1,952,000 | 1.1% |
